The tool allows eligible individuals affiliated with specific organizations to determine the pre-negotiated price for new Lincoln vehicles. It functions as a digital system that calculates the price based on the applicable program and the vehicle’s MSRP, factoring in any eligible incentives. As an example, an employee of a participating supplier can utilize it to see the final cost of a new Navigator before visiting a dealership, thereby streamlining the purchase process.

Its importance stems from its provision of transparency and simplified pricing for eligible purchasers. By providing a clear, upfront price, it eliminates the need for extensive negotiation and offers a guaranteed discount. Historically, such programs were introduced to recognize and reward the contributions of individuals associated with partner companies and organizations, fostering stronger relationships and providing a tangible benefit.

Question 1: What is the Lincoln X-Plan, and who is eligible?

The Lincoln X-Plan is a vehicle purchase program offering eligible employees and members of select partner organizations a pre-negotiated price on new Lincoln vehicles. Eligibility is determined by affiliation with a company or group participating in the program. Verification of eligibility is required prior to purchase.

Question 2: How does the pricing calculator function?

The pricing calculator utilizes a database of pre-negotiated prices and available incentives. Upon entering the vehicle configuration details, the system calculates the final price by applying the X-Plan discount and any compatible incentives. The accuracy of the calculated price relies on the correct entry of vehicle specifications and verification of applicable incentives.

Question 3: Are all Lincoln dealerships required to participate in the X-Plan?

No, not all Lincoln dealerships are obligated to participate. Participation is voluntary and dealership-specific. Confirmation of a dealer’s participation is crucial before initiating the purchase process. Contacting the dealership directly to verify participation is recommended.

Question 4: Can the X-Plan be combined with all other Lincoln incentives and rebates?

The X-Plan can be combined with certain, but not all, publicly available incentives and rebates offered by Lincoln. The compatibility of incentives varies and is subject to change. The pricing calculator indicates which incentives are applicable alongside the X-Plan pricing.

Question 5: What documentation is required to utilize the X-Plan at a participating dealership?

Documentation requirements typically include proof of eligibility, such as a company ID or other verification from the affiliated organization. The dealership may also require a control number or certificate generated through the X-Plan system. Specific documentation requirements may vary, and contacting the dealership directly is recommended.

Question 6: Does the X-Plan price include taxes, title, and registration fees?

The X-Plan price typically does not include taxes, title, and registration fees. These fees are the responsibility of the purchaser and are added to the calculated price at the time of sale. Dealerships are responsible for providing a detailed breakdown of all applicable fees and taxes.
